While royal sources announce that Lilibet will be baptized in the United States, Meghan and Harry refute all current claims.

The Meghan and Harry saga continues. According to the informationtarget = “_ blank”> from Daily Mail, Meghan Markle and Prince Harry have not yet ruled out the idea of ​​baptizing their daughter Lilibet in the United Kingdom. For several weeks, this event has been the subject of debate across the Channel, in particular with advisers to Queen Elizabeth II. Still, it would allow the Duke and Duchess of Sussex to officially present their little Lilibet Diana to the Sovereign, who until now has only seen her on video.

But according to royal sources cited by the British tabloid, the couple would opt instead for an episcopal ceremony in California, judging that it was “Highly unlikely” that the little one be baptized at Windsor Castle. Information that the main stakeholders wanted to deny. A spokesperson for Meghan and Harry explained to the Telegraph that the baptismal plans were always “being discussed” and that current claims were only “Mere speculation”.
